Abstract (EN)
This study deals with 18th-century poet Mazlûm's masnavi Yûsuf u Züleyhâ. It consists of an introduction section and four main chapters. The introduction focuses on Yûsuf's story and related religious references including a brief overview of what the Qur'an and Torah tell about Yûsuf. It presents information on poets writing the story of Yûsuf u Züleyhâ in eastern and western literature and their works. It also discusses the effect of the story on the modern Turkish literature, culture, and art. The first chapter attempts to provide information on the life of Mazlûm, about whom no information is available, on the basis of the author's works. It introduces his only known work Yûsuf u Züleyhâ and its copies. The second chapter involves an analysis of the masnavi including its structural and contextual properties, motifs, and fairy tale elements. The structural analysis deals with verse forms, rhymes, rhythms, language, style, figures of speech, proverbs, and idioms. The contextual analysis includes a summary of the masnavi and addresses characters, narrative items, methods of narration, religion, nature, social life, and human. It also presents motifs and fairy tale elements in the story. The third chapter compares Persian poet Mollâ Câmî's (also known as Djāmī) Yûsuf u Züleyhâ masnavi and Mazlûm's Yûsuf u Züleyhâ masnavi in terms of chapter titles, introduction, story, and epilogue. Finally, the fourth chapter involves an edition critique and analytical review of Yûsuf u Züleyhâ based on the two copies. It also explains the way by which the edition critique is formed and detects the spelling features of the text. All in all, this study introduced the Yûsuf u Züleyhâ masnavi written in Azerbaijani Turkish in the 18th century and its author using the pen name Mazlûm to Turkish literature.
